May 28, 2002

Alliance for Downtown New York, Inc. 120 Broadway, Ste. 3340 New York 10271 Attention: Ms Shirley Jaffe

Re: 44 Trinity Pl. (aka 81 Greenwich St.)

Dear Ms Jaffe:

I have your letter of May 13 regarding the proposed cleaning of buildings near the site of the terrorist attacks of September 11, 2001. Please review the enclosed correspondence with DEC on this matter. The agency's communications with this office have been worryingly inconsistent, exposing EBW, LLC, the owner of the referenced property, to charges of neglect and worse, despite the documented fact that the owner has followed and exceeded DEC directives since September 14. In discussions on the matter, DEC personnel have been reasonable, but the agency's written communications continue to leave EBW, LLC vulnerable to those charges.

Is there any way in which you can help to resolve this worrisome situation?

Thank you in advance for any assistance you can offer.

Yours Truly,

Bernard McElhone for EBW, LLC
